Digital music distributor Media Service Provider (MSP), who are probably best known in this country for working with Virgin Media on the MusicFish branded all you can eat download and streaming service that they never launched due to being unable to agree terms with the labels (Virgin have of course since launched their tie up with Spotify), have appointed a new chief executive to replace the departing Paul Hitchman.Graham Sargood is actually an ex Virgin Media staffer with 20 years experience in the telecoms industry that MSP is targeting to run music services for and moves from his current non-executive director role at the music on demand platform operator to take over operation responsibilities from Hitchman.
Sargood said of his appointment:
"MSP is poised to accelerate its growth in 2012 with the roll-out of further services across multiple territories and user platforms. I am very much looking forward to working with the existing team at MSP to fulfil the opportunities the company has to move to the next level of growth and product evolution."The MSP platform is used by Eircom's MusicHub service.
